Xcode5.1から64bit向けのビルドもデフォルトで行うようになったらしいです。
あるプロジェクトで組み込んでいるライブラリの関係上32bitのみでビルドしたかったのですが、上記の内容が関係してXcode5.1にしたとたんエラーになってしまいました。
解決方法は「Build Settings」→「Architecture」に$(ARCHS_STANDARD_32_BIT)
を追加し、もともと入力されている$(ARCHS_STANDARD)
を削除することです。
この$(ARCHS_STANDARD)
の示す値がXcode5.0までだと64bit(arm64
)が入っていない、ということですかね。